In late July, news broke in The New York Times, Boston Globe, and National Public Radio about the Berkshire Museum in Pittsfield, Massachusetts, deciding to deaccession forty works of art, thrusting the topic of museum collection policies, funding, and public trust once again into the national spotlight. The museum claimed that the deaccessioning was compliant with temporary new guidelines from the AAMD that allow institutions to deaccession works if the funds gained through their sales go toward the “direct care” of the collection.
